Quiet Brakes Can Hide Wear:

Three Brake Checks That Matter
Many drivers assume their brakes will squeal, grind, or trigger a dashboard warning when something needs attention. Unfortunately, brake wear does not always announce itself.
Your brakes may remain quiet even when the pads are wearing thin, the rotors show signs of damage, or the brake fluid is no longer performing as it should. That is why waiting for a noise is not the best way to determine the condition of your braking system.

Why Quiet Brakes May Still Need Attention
Some brake pads include wear indicators designed to produce a squealing sound when the pads become thin. However, not every vehicle or brake component will give you the same warning.
Brake noise may also be affected by the design of the pads, weather conditions, accumulated dust, or the way the components are wearing. In some cases, significant wear may be present without a noticeable sound.
A quiet braking system does not automatically mean something is wrong. It simply means that sound alone cannot confirm the condition of your brakes.
A proper inspection provides much more useful information.
1. Brake Pad and Rotor Condition
Brake pads create friction against the rotors to slow and stop your vehicle. Each time you apply the brakes, a small amount of pad material wears away.
During an inspection, we check the remaining pad thickness rather than relying on noise or appearance from outside the wheel. Measurements help determine how much usable material remains and whether wear is even across the braking system.
We also inspect the rotors for visible wear patterns and other concerns, including:
- Scoring or deep grooves
- Uneven wear
- Heat-related discoloration
- Rust or corrosion
- Cracks or surface damage
- Differences in wear from one side to the other
Pad and rotor condition should be considered together. Installing new pads against damaged or excessively worn rotors may affect braking performance and shorten the life of the new components.
Measurements and visible wear patterns give us a clearer picture of what your vehicle needs.
2. Brake Fluid Performance
Brake fluid plays a critical role in transferring the force from the brake pedal to the braking components at the wheels. Over time, the fluid can absorb moisture and become contaminated.
Old or contaminated brake fluid may not perform as effectively under demanding conditions. Because this change happens gradually, drivers may not notice it during normal daily driving.
A brake fluid performance check helps us evaluate the condition of the fluid instead of guessing based only on its age or appearance. The results can help determine whether the fluid is still providing appropriate performance or whether a brake fluid service should be considered.
Vehicle manufacturers may provide different service recommendations, so brake fluid condition should be evaluated along with the maintenance requirements for your particular vehicle.
3. Brake Response Inspection
Measurements tell us a great deal, but we also need to consider how the braking system feels and behaves during normal operation.
A brake response inspection may identify changes such as:
- A soft or spongy brake pedal
- Excessive pedal travel
- Delayed braking response
- Pulsation through the pedal
- Pulling to one side while braking
- Unusual vibration
- Inconsistent pedal feel
These symptoms can have several possible causes. A pulsating pedal, for example, does not automatically confirm that one specific part should be replaced. The entire system should be evaluated before a repair recommendation is made.
The goal is to connect the vehicle’s behavior with the physical inspection and measurements.

Do Not Wait for Grinding
Once brakes begin making a grinding sound, the friction material on the pads may already be severely worn. Continuing to drive could damage additional components and reduce braking performance.
Other signs that should prompt an inspection include:
- A brake or ABS warning light
- Increased stopping distance
- Pulling while braking
- A soft or sinking pedal
- Vibration or pulsation
- A burning odor near a wheel
- Fluid underneath the vehicle
- Any sudden change in braking response
If your brake pedal goes to the floor, braking ability changes suddenly, or the vehicle does not stop normally, avoid driving it and seek professional assistance immediately.
